Components of a Ceiling Fan Light Chain Pull Switch
A ceiling fan light chain pull switch typically consists of the following components:
- Pull chain: A chain that is attached to the switch mechanism and pulled to activate or deactivate the light.
- Switch housing: A small enclosure that contains the switch mechanism and electrical connections.
- Switch mechanism: A two-way, self-returning switch that controls the flow of electricity to the light.
- Mounting bracket: A bracket that attaches the switch housing to the ceiling fan canopy.
Types of Ceiling Fan Light Chain Pull Switches
Ceiling fan light chain pull switches come in two primary types:
- Standard pull switch: A simple switch that turns the light on or off when the chain is pulled.
- Multi-speed pull switch: A switch that controls both the light and the fan speed, allowing you to cycle through different fan speeds by pulling the chain multiple times.
Installation Considerations
Installing a ceiling fan light chain pull switch is generally straightforward, but it requires basic electrical knowledge and safety precautions. Ensure that the power to the ceiling fan is turned off at the circuit breaker before proceeding with the installation.
The switch housing is typically mounted to the ceiling fan canopy using screws. Once the housing is secured, connect the electrical wires from the switch housing to the corresponding wires in the ceiling fan. If you are unsure about any of these steps, it is recommended to consult with a qualified electrician.
Troubleshooting Light Chain Pull Switches
If your ceiling fan light chain pull switch is malfunctioning, there are a few common issues to check:
- Broken pull chain: If the pull chain is broken or frayed, it will need to be replaced.
- Loose connections: Check the electrical connections inside the switch housing to ensure they are tight and not corroded.
- Faulty switch mechanism: The switch mechanism itself may need to be replaced if it has become worn out or damaged.
Replacement and Maintenance
Over time, ceiling fan light chain pull switches may need to be replaced due to wear and tear or electrical issues. To replace a pull switch, follow these steps:
- Turn off the power to the ceiling fan.
- Remove the mounting screws and detach the switch housing from the ceiling fan canopy.
- Disconnect the electrical wires and remove the old pull switch.
- Connect the electrical wires to the new pull switch and insert it into the housing.
- Reattach the mounting screws and restore power to the ceiling fan.
Regular maintenance of your ceiling fan light chain pull switch is crucial to ensure its longevity and proper functioning. Clean the pull chain and switch housing periodically with a damp cloth to remove dust and debris. Check for any signs of wear or damage and address them promptly.
